Overview: Sony London Studio has recently developed a number of virtual reality experiences for the Sony PlayStation VR, including "The Deep", "VR Luge" and "The London Heist" that have been showcased at GDC, E3 and other events to great acclaim.
In this talk you'll find out how London Studio has focused its rendering technology and tools to plan for the unknown, including a look at our flexible forward renderer and tooling.The technical and artistic challenges that were overcome in making great quality within the demands of VR and the optimization strategies employed will also be discussed.
The techniques that will be shared can help studios producing VR content improve the quality of their visuals, but many are also applicable to traditional games.
